000001893 520__ $$2eng$$aIn this paper a method for determination of shear stress distribution over arbitrary cross section is described. Cross section is loaded by any combination of shear and torsion. Other inner forces are not considered at this presented method. PDE are formulated for this problem, which are transformed by variational principle to the deformational variant of the finite element method. The solution of overall internal forces and stiffness characteristic of cross section including plasticity for using in a beam element model is suggested in this paper.
